Predicting Understandability of a Software Project: A Comparison of Two Surveys

نویسندگان

  • Ali Afzal Malik
  • Barry Boehm
چکیده

This paper summarizes the results of an empirical study conducted to explore the relative importance of eight pertinent COCOMO II model drivers in predicting the understandability of a software project. Here understandability of the project is measured solely from the perspective of the development team. This empirical study employed a survey that was targeted towards experienced practitioners. Results from this survey are compared with the corresponding results from a prior similar survey conducted on graduate students. While this comparison reveals some interesting differences between the importance given to each of the eight model drivers by these two categories of individuals it also highlights some subtle similarities.
